Bobbee
“A variant spelling of Bobbe with an extended -ee ending, emphasizing a feminine or whimsical quality. Popular in mid-20th-century American baby naming, particularly post-1940s, this spelling reflects the era's trend toward creative name variations and gender-specific modifications of traditional names.”
Bobbee is a girl's name of Germanic origin. A variant spelling of Bobbe with an extended -ee ending, emphasizing a feminine or whimsical quality. Popular in mid-20th-century American baby naming, particularly post-1940s, this spelling reflects the era's trend toward creative name variations and gender-specific modifications of traditional names.
A dated spelling variant most associated with 1940s-1960s American naming trends.
